Five new skills (`/ios-qa`, `/ios-fix`, `/ios-design-review`, `/ios-clean`, `/ios-sync`) bring the fork from `time-attack/gstack` into upstream with the hardening it needed to actually ship. The architecture's load-bearing insight: drop XCTest, drop the simulator, drop WebDriverAgent. Embed an HTTP server in the iOS app under test, drive it from a Mac-side bun daemon over the USB CoreDevice IPv6 tunnel. The agent reads your Swift source, codegens typed `@Observable` accessors via a SwiftPM swift-syntax tool (with a TS fallback for fast first-runs), deploys a debug bridge, and runs a closed find→fix→verify loop. With the optional `--tailnet` flag, the Mac daemon also binds Tailscale and accepts authenticated remote calls — your $500 Mac mini + an iPhone you already have replaces the BrowserStack line item.
|
||||
|
||||
Two Mac-side CLIs ship alongside the skills: `gstack-ios-qa-daemon` brokers traffic between the agent and the connected iPhone, and `gstack-ios-qa-mint` is the owner-grant tool for the tailnet allowlist (grant / revoke / list). The full end-to-end walkthrough lives at [docs/howto-ios-testing-with-gstack.md](docs/howto-ios-testing-with-gstack.md).
|
||||
|
||||
SwiftUI Buttons synthesized-tap support: on iOS 18+ the hit-test resolves through `_UIHitTestContext` and walks up to `SwiftUI.UIKitGestureContainer` (a UIResponder that isn't a UIView). The KIF-derived `DebugBridgeTouch` Objective-C target passes that responder through to `UITouch.setView:` directly, mirroring KIF PR #1323. Verified live: counter went 0 → 4 across four `POST /tap` requests on a real iPhone 17 Pro Max running iOS 26.5.

| Surface | Fork as-is | Shipped |
|
||||
|---|---|---|
|
||||
| StateServer bind | `0.0.0.0:9999`, zero auth | `::1` + `127.0.0.1` only; bearer-token gate; boot token rotates within ~5s of daemon spawn so anything scraping `os_log` past then sees a dead credential |
|
||||
| SwiftUI Button taps on iOS 18+ | synthesized taps silently dropped (hit-test walks past `SwiftUI.UIKitGestureContainer` because it isn't a UIView) | `DBT_HitTestView` returns the responder as-is and `UITouch.setView:` accepts it; verified live on iOS 26.5 |
|
||||
| Release-build safety | none (any `#if DEBUG` mistake ships the bridge) | structural `Package.swift` `.when(configuration: .debug)` + CI `swift build -c release` invariant test that fails if the `DebugBridge` symbol appears |
|
||||
| SPM package shape | one target, missing the Obj-C touch synth implementation entirely | three drop-in product targets — `DebugBridgeCore` (Swift, cross-platform), `DebugBridgeTouch` (Obj-C, iOS-only, KIF-derived), `DebugBridgeUI` (Swift, iOS-only); the consuming app adds one dependency on `DebugBridgeUI` and gets the rest transitively |
|
||||
| Codegen failure modes covered | regex breaks on computed properties, generics, multi-line types | swift-syntax AST (production), strict TS regex fallback for tests; 3 dedicated fixtures pin the known failure shapes |
|
||||
| Multi-agent device contention | none | per-device session lock with sliding timeout on mutations only; concurrent `/session/acquire` race test |
|
||||
| Remote control | not in scope | Tailscale identity-gated `/auth/mint`; capability tiers (observe/interact/mutate/restore); 1h default session TTL (24h cap); audit log of every authenticated mutating request; hashed-identity attempts log |
